Why women leaders need executive coaching?
Despite progress in workplace equality, women in leadership roles still encounter distinct barriers:
- Breaking through the glass ceiling: Women leaders often face bias and limited opportunities for advancement. Coaching provides strategies to overcome these challenges and assert their leadership presence.
- Imposter syndrome: Even high-achieving women can struggle with self-doubt. Executive coaching helps build confidence and recognize the value of their contributions.
- Work-Life balance: Balancing leadership responsibilities with personal commitments can be overwhelming. Coaching equips women with time management and delegation strategies to maintain balance and prevent burnout.

Benefits of executive coaching for women leaders
Investing in executive coaching delivers measurable personal and professional benefits:
- Increased confidence and leadership presence: Learn to lead with authenticity and authority.
- Enhanced decision-making and problem-solving skills: Develop the ability to make strategic choices with clarity and precision.
- Improved communication and executive presence: Gain skills to articulate ideas persuasively and build influence within your organization.
- Stronger negotiation and influence skills: Master the art of negotiation to secure promotions, pay raises, and leadership opportunities.
- Career advancement and personal fulfilment: Achieve career milestones while aligning professional goals with personal values.

What does an executive coach do?
An executive coach provides personalized guidance to help leaders enhance their skills, overcome challenges, and achieve professional growth. Through structured sessions, they offer insights, feedback, and strategies tailored to your leadership goals.
Is executive coaching worth the investment?
Yes. Executive coaching helps leaders improve decision-making, communication, and leadership effectiveness. This can lead to better business outcomes, career advancement, and personal growth. Organizations also see increased engagement and performance from coached leaders.
